I received my Master’s in Social Work with an emphasis in clinical social work from West Chester University. I’m licensed as a Clinical Social Worker with the PA state board of Social Workers, Marriage & Family Therapists & Professional Counselors.

​

I have 12 years of experience in the roles of Trauma Therapist, Behavior Consultant, Trainer and Clinical Supervisor. I've worked in a variety of settings including community mental health agencies, crisis response centers, mobile crisis agencies, inpatient hospitals, residential treatment facilities, community residential rehabilitation programs, within the Pennsylvania judicial system and with medical and behavioral health insurance providers. I have worked with children, teens, adults, families and couples to overcome challenges related to past and present trauma, behavioral concerns and emotional disorders.

​

My specialized areas are mood and behavior disorders, anxiety/panic disorders, grief & loss, postpartum & child loss, women's issues, relationship issues, family conflict and anger management. My expertise is working alongside my clients to help them overcome past trauma and learn skills and techniques to improve emotional resiliency and create behavior change.

​

I am trained in Play Therapy, Parent-Child Interaction Therapy (PCIT), Motivational Interviewing (MI),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), Trauma focused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(TF-CBT),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T), & Solution Focused Brief Therapy (SFBT)
